We want to mimic the look and feel of the data accessibility information on the study details tab, which is being implemented in VEuPathDB/EbrcWebsiteCommon#143

Final mockups are here: https://www.figma.com/file/mDKIOrpnSwwMjz9acRg3qC/Add-data-accessibility-information-(study-details-%26-downloads-tabs)?node-id=47%3A365

image

To do:

  • Create a header for "Data Accessibility" using same font styling as for "My Subset" and "Full dataset"
  • Place data accessibility sentence under the "Data Accessibility" header of
  • Update verbiage explaining data accessibility (see below)

For users who don’t have access permissions or are not logged in:

For studies with public access:

Data downloads for this study are public. Data is available without logging in.

For studies with controlled access:

To download data please register or log in and request access. Data will be available immediately following request submission.

For studies with protected access:

To download data please register or log in and request access. Data will be available upon study team review and approval.

For users who are logged in and have access to the study data:

For studies with public access:

Data downloads for this study are public. Data is available without logging in.

For studies with controlled access:

You have been granted access to download the data.

For studies with protected access:

You have been granted access to download the data.

Note: request access is a link that should take you to the popup:
